Hi all iOS 9 sports a brand new News app which allows you to read the news straight from your device. But there is a catch. While it is available in the US, UK and Australia initially, you have to change your device's region to United States. To do this:
1. Open Settings > general > language and region. 2. Double tap region and double tap on "United States" in the long list of countries. You may want to use your rotor and set it to headings so you can jump to the letter quickly and easily. 3. Double tap the "done" button, and reboot your device when prompted. I've just done this on my iPhone 5s, and now have the News app. It is completely accessible with VoiceOver. Happy reading!
